What is the cancellation policy?

The cancellation policy for e2ride Bike Tours can vary depending on the specific tour and the timing of the cancellation. Generally, e2ride strives to accommodate its participants' needs while also managing the logistics of tours effectively. Typically, it may be necessary to notify e2ride of a cancellation several weeks in advance to receive a full refund. If a cancellation occurs closer to the tour date, there may be a partial refund or no refund at all, depending on the circumstances and how much notice is provided. Also, e2ride may offer the possibility of rescheduling or transferring a booking to another participant under certain conditions. This could be a good alternative if someone cannot make the original tour. It is crucial to understand the specific terms of the cancellation policy at the time of booking, as these can differ by trip or destination.
